Output eaba6425add85ad1e2d3e3bbcc0c59603fbd7cb798221b849cf9051cbc999bae:1

value
2107828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b5ed58dce1a5797c16d9309247d749bc986dc0 OP_EQUAL
address
3BWYAb6eq9iyxehuwWZa9k3zkHHVzqLNm1
transaction
eaba6425add85ad1e2d3e3bbcc0c59603fbd7cb798221b849cf9051cbc999bae
confirmations
385028
spent
true